5. 一批货物,第一次运走总量的 20%,第二次运走余下货物的 25%。两次运走货物的质量相比,()。
A.第一次多
B.第二次多
C.一样多
D.无法确定多少

答案
C
解析
把货物总量看作单位“1”。第一次运走的质量:1×20%=0.2;余下货物质量:1-20%=80%,第二次运走的质量:80%×25%=0.2。因为0.2=0.2,所以两次运走的货物质量一样多。
